The Indian Heritage Fashion Show 2022

Posted on June 28, 2022 By

June 28: A few decades back, ethnic attire used to mean mononous attire in designs that were older than one could imagine. In the present era, people are desirous of being fashionable and expect uniqueness in their attire. Fashion has become a way of life and expression for many.

The Mumbai Edition of the India Heritage Fashion Show was organised on June 25, 2022 at Samarambh Banquets, Thane, where fashion truly met culture. The wholehearted people behind this grandeur were from Hey Foundation and Talentica India. It was a charitable event where emphasis was laid on the promotion of the varied and everlasting traditions and culture of India. Designers and make-up artists from different parts of the country gathered to prepare their suave models, who set the ramp on fire. The show was choreographed by Shiva Dada.

The runway models included were well established and even those who were struggling in their careers, but the performance that was put up by the participants was nothing less than a grand spectacle to be witnessed. The prime concern in the Indian fashion industry is handloom, which is reaching a slow and gradual death that needs to be curbed. “Handloom is much more versatile than we could ever imagine.” It is just that the handloom industry needs to be tapped and marketed well, “said Dr. Sangeeta Patil, founder of Hey Foundation.

The event also supported the women weavers of Paithani Saree, who have continuously  dedicated their lives to this art. “Being vocal for local” is what Dr Sangeeta Patil said when asked about the most important thing required in the fashion industry at the moment, apart from emphasising handloom.
